Materials and Tools Needed for Sealing Drafty Windows

To effectively seal drafty windows, having the right materials and tools is essential. The choice of materials depends on the type of window, the severity of the drafts, and whether the sealing is temporary or permanent.

Common materials include weatherstripping, caulking, and window insulation film. Weatherstripping is ideal for sealing movable parts such as sashes or sliding windows, while caulking works best for stationary cracks and gaps. Window insulation film provides an additional barrier against cold air and can be applied seasonally.

Essential tools for the job include:

  • Utility knife or scissors for cutting weatherstripping and film
  • Caulk gun for applying sealant smoothly
  • Putty knife or scraper to remove old caulking or paint
  • Measuring tape for precise measurements
  • Screwdriver for window hardware adjustments
  • Cleaning supplies such as rubbing alcohol and cloths to prepare surfaces

Preparing the window surface properly before applying any sealing material ensures better adhesion and longevity of the seal.

Types of Weatherstripping for Windows

Weatherstripping comes in various forms designed to fit different types of windows and gaps. Understanding the differences will help in selecting the most effective option.

  • Foam Tape: Easy to apply, compressible foam tape is suitable for irregular gaps but may wear out quickly in high-traffic areas.
  • V-Strip (Tension Seal): Made from vinyl or metal, V-strip folds to create a tight seal and is durable for sash windows.
  • Felt: An economical choice, felt strips are simple to install but less durable and less effective in severe weather.
  • Rubber or Vinyl: These provide a more robust and airtight seal, ideal for larger gaps.
  • Door Sweeps and Sashes: Used primarily on sliding or double-hung windows to seal moving parts.
Type of Weatherstripping Best For Durability Ease of Installation Cost
Foam Tape Irregular gaps, interior use Moderate Very Easy Low
V-Strip (Tension Seal) Sash windows, narrow gaps High Moderate Moderate
Felt Low traffic windows Low Very Easy Very Low
Rubber/Vinyl Large gaps, exterior use High Moderate Moderate

Applying Caulk to Seal Window Frames

Caulking is one of the most effective ways to seal cracks and gaps around window frames where air leaks commonly occur. Proper application is critical to achieving a long-lasting airtight seal.

Before caulking, remove any old, cracked, or peeling caulk using a putty knife or scraper. Clean the surface thoroughly to remove dust, dirt, and moisture. A clean, dry surface ensures better adhesion.

Use a high-quality exterior-grade silicone or acrylic latex caulk designed for windows. Silicone caulk offers superior flexibility and water resistance, while acrylic latex caulk is easier to apply and paint over.

To apply caulk:

  • Cut the tip of the caulk tube at a 45-degree angle to control the bead size.
  • Use a caulk gun to apply a steady, continuous bead along the gap.
  • Smooth the bead with a wet finger or a caulk smoothing tool within a few minutes of application.
  • Remove excess caulk promptly to prevent messy buildup.

Allow the caulk to cure fully as recommended by the manufacturer, usually 24 hours, before exposing it to moisture or painting.

Using Window Insulation Film for Additional Draft Protection

Window insulation film is a transparent plastic sheet applied to the interior side of windows to reduce heat loss and block drafts. It is a cost-effective, non-permanent solution suitable for renters or seasonal use.

The installation process typically involves:

  • Cleaning the window glass thoroughly.
  • Measuring and cutting the film slightly larger than the window dimensions.
  • Applying double-sided tape around the window frame to secure the film.
  • Attaching the film to the tape and smoothing out wrinkles.
  • Using a hair dryer to shrink the film, creating a taut, invisible barrier.

This film creates an insulating air pocket between the window and the room, reducing cold air infiltration and improving energy efficiency.

Additional Tips for Maintaining Draft-Free Windows

Beyond sealing gaps, regular maintenance helps keep windows airtight:

  • Check weatherstripping annually for signs of wear or damage and replace as needed.
  • Lubricate window tracks and hardware to ensure smooth operation and proper closure.
  • Inspect window panes for cracks or damage and repair or replace them promptly.
  • Consider installing interior storm windows for extra insulation in colder climates.
  • Use heavy curtains or thermal blinds to reduce drafts and heat loss at night.

Implementing these practices extends the life of your window seals and enhances overall comfort.

Identifying Sources of Drafts Around Windows

Properly sealing drafty windows begins with accurately identifying where air leaks occur. Common areas where drafts infiltrate include:

  • Window frames and sashes: Gaps between the frame and the sash can allow air penetration.
  • Weatherstripping deterioration: Old or damaged weatherstripping loses its effectiveness over time.
  • Cracks in window panes or surrounding walls: Small cracks or gaps can create continuous airflow.
  • Improperly sealed or missing caulking: The joint between the window frame and the wall often requires caulk to prevent drafts.
  • Loose or damaged window hardware: Hinges, locks, and latches that do not close tightly may leave gaps.

To pinpoint these sources, perform a draft test by running your hand around the perimeter of the window on a cold day or use a smoke pencil or incense stick to detect air movement.

Effective Methods for Sealing Drafty Windows

Addressing drafts involves a combination of sealing techniques and materials tailored to the window’s condition and design. The following methods are the most effective:

Method Description Best Use Cases Materials Needed
Weatherstripping Applying flexible strips of material around the sash to close gaps between moving parts. Windows with operable sashes, sliding or double-hung windows. Foam tape, V-strip, felt, rubber, or silicone weatherstripping.
Caulking Sealing cracks and gaps between the window frame and the adjacent wall or trim. Stationary window frames and exterior joints. Silicone or acrylic latex caulk with a caulking gun.
Window Insulation Film Applying a transparent plastic film over the interior window surface to reduce air leakage. Older, single-pane windows where replacement is not immediately feasible. Plastic shrink film kits, double-sided tape, hair dryer.
Draft Stoppers and Window Inserts Temporary or semi-permanent inserts and draft snakes placed at sills or over gaps. Rental properties or situations requiring non-invasive solutions. Fabric draft snakes, custom-fit acrylic or glass inserts.
Replacing Window Components Upgrading or repairing damaged sashes, panes, or hardware to restore seal integrity. Windows with extensive damage or inefficiency. Replacement parts, glazing compound, professional installation tools.

Step-by-Step Guide to Applying Weatherstripping

Weatherstripping is a highly effective and relatively simple method for reducing drafts. Follow these steps to apply it correctly:

  1. Measure the window perimeter: Use a tape measure to determine the length of each side where weatherstripping will be applied.
  2. Choose the appropriate material: Select weatherstripping suited to your window type and climate conditions. Foam tape is ideal for irregular gaps, while V-strip works well for sash windows.
  3. Clean the surface: Thoroughly clean the frame and sash surfaces to remove dirt and grease for better adhesion.
  4. Cut weatherstripping to length: Use scissors or a utility knife to prepare pieces matching measured lengths.
  5. Apply the weatherstripping: Peel adhesive backing or nail the strips in place along the sash or frame, ensuring tight contact without obstructing window operation.
  6. Test window operation: Open and close the window to confirm smooth movement and an effective seal.

Best Practices for Caulking Window Frames

Proper caulking prevents drafts by sealing the junction between the window frame and the wall. Implement the following best practices for durable results:

  • Inspect existing caulk: Remove old, cracked, or peeling caulk using a putty knife or scraper.
  • Clean the joint: Ensure the surface is dry and free of dust, paint, or debris.
  • Select the right caulk: Use exterior-grade silicone caulk for waterproofing and flexibility, or acrylic latex caulk for paintability.
  • Apply caulk evenly: Use a caulking gun to dispense a continuous bead along the joint. Smooth it with a caulk finishing tool or your finger dipped in water.
  • Allow proper curing time: Follow manufacturer instructions for drying times before exposing the area to moisture or painting.

    Frequently Asked Questions (FAQs)

    What are the most effective materials for sealing drafty windows?
    Weatherstripping, caulk, and window insulation film are among the most effective materials to seal drafty windows. Each serves different purposes: weatherstripping seals movable parts, caulk fills gaps and cracks, and insulation film adds an extra barrier against cold air.

    How can I identify where drafts are coming from around my windows?
    Use a candle or incense stick to detect air movement by observing the flame or smoke near window edges. Additionally, feeling with your hand for cold spots or using a thermal camera can help pinpoint draft sources.

    Is sealing drafty windows a DIY project or should I hire a professional?
    Sealing drafty windows is often a manageable DIY task if the drafts are minor and involve simple fixes like applying weatherstripping or caulk. However, for extensive damage or older windows requiring repair or replacement, consulting a professional is advisable.

    How often should window seals and weatherstripping be inspected or replaced?
    Inspect window seals and weatherstripping annually, preferably before the heating season. Replace any materials that appear cracked, brittle, or compressed to maintain optimal insulation.

    Can sealing drafty windows help reduce energy bills?
    Yes, properly sealing drafty windows significantly reduces heat loss, improving energy efficiency and lowering heating and cooling costs by preventing unwanted air exchange.

    Are there temporary solutions to seal drafty windows during colder months?
    Temporary solutions include applying plastic window insulation kits, using draft stoppers or snakes at the base of windows, and applying removable weatherstripping tape to block drafts effectively during colder months.
